Output 67c89332a16abdba56c6a0bc25d88af93d7e1eac3011ba45886a91026ff9915c:6

value
15895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ac79cc52ef77ee2e530e8f45be12e3ed5a48836c OP_EQUAL
address
3HQz4DpDR5nCmxqxWvmaPZ5jvPvBMu6wPR
transaction
67c89332a16abdba56c6a0bc25d88af93d7e1eac3011ba45886a91026ff9915c
spent
true